Output 66bac1ae89af6606e6b815174da9ab16568a9fab19795779511da680d992d91a:0

value
1010496
script pubkey
OP_HASH160 OP_PUSHBYTES_20 953c382bc85f235313e3a4218fd9ee27e4c1ac75 OP_EQUAL
address
3FJ6kFATMRVH5sN44uRbyvPg2GUxZo1JG3
transaction
66bac1ae89af6606e6b815174da9ab16568a9fab19795779511da680d992d91a
spent
true